Ok after one visit to the Island and reading this forum and archives of the Beacon I am very interested in possibly investing in some property on the Island. However I question if I can actually do it. So here is some information about me and what I am thinking about and I am hoping I can get some feedback about possibilities.

I am about 10 years from retiring from civil service. My wife is about 15 years from retirement but works on an academic calendar so her summers are free. Our 2 duaghters are close to being (hopefully) out of the home. So my thoughts were to find a small home that would be a summer residence, or perhaps buy some property with the idea of building closer to retirement. Unless we hit the lotto tonight I don't have a ton of money. My wife loves the water and I love the woods.

So if anyone wants to make any suggestions as to where to start? what to research? where to look? any ideas of any kind please feel free to chime in!

We purchased land about 10 years ago. We had a land contract and then built about 8 years ago. We love it. We worked with Ed Wojan's real estate office. He has a very good reputation for being honest and hard working.

Land prices have gone up immensely since we bought. So the sooner you buy, the better. It's an excellent investment.

Since so many baby boomers will be retiring soon, the prices will do nothing but go up for land in desirable retirement areas.

I don't think you would ever regret it. Land in the woods is cheaper than on the water and you can always drive a few miles to a beach.
